Latest Patents

Among his latest patents are the "Tire building method and rubber strip bonding apparatus" and the "Method of building carcass band and stitcher apparatus." The tire building method focuses on achieving lamination without voids when constructing tires from multiple rubber members. This invention utilizes holding rolls and two sets of stitching rolls to perform independent pressing motions, ensuring that the rubber strip is effectively pressed and bonded during the winding process. The stitcher apparatus is designed to pressure-bond a carcass ply sheet onto a rubber sheet member, utilizing a ring-shaped frame and multiple pressure-bond rollers to enhance the bonding process.
